Output 26bada3793e834e55ba0449996493643a8e0115aa8cc56e208310518bbbbc074:0

value
41888
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ae322daf18d29a3e0ef1d2a7ee1677d53eb733e7 OP_EQUAL
address
3Ha5cP8FuBVVGLDnw6K8XMejBq9wTiUBGC
transaction
26bada3793e834e55ba0449996493643a8e0115aa8cc56e208310518bbbbc074